This experiential exhibition introduces the entire world of the film "Panda Go Panda," which is said to be the source of Takahata and Miyazaki's work and is considered their most important work.
There are plenty of fun photo spots, such as a replica of Mimiko's house, where the story is set, and fluffy objects of Papanda and Pan-chan!
There will also be special exhibits of exclusive materials such as photographs and merchandise from the panda boom that swept Japan at the time, as well as original film drawings and posters.
50 years after its theatrical release, Panda Go Panda continues to shine and is loved by a wide range of generations, from children to adults as well as families.

The annual Shizuoka Theater Festival (World Theater Festival Shizuoka) is carefully planned and organized by the Shizuoka Performing Arts Center (SPAC). Since the establishment of SPAC in Shizuoka Prefecture in 1995, it has been set as a pioneer in Japan's publicly funded performing arts. In 1997, under the leadership of the first artistic director Tadashi Suzuki, SPAC was officially launched and began its artistic journey. Since Satoshi Miyagi took over as chief artistic director in 2007, SPAC has not only entered a new era of rapid development, but also is committed to "bringing the world closer together through performing arts."
